What the Fix Involves

A full replacement on a house this age means pulling the old door, the old track, and usually the old springs, since torsion springs from a 2001 install are long past their rated cycles even if they haven't snapped yet. We set new track, new springs sized to the new door's weight, and the door itself, insulated panel sections if that's what you picked, single-layer steel if it's a secondary structure like a shop or detached garage.

The climate here runs a moderate heat load rather than extreme cold, so insulation is more about noise and garage temperature in summer than about keeping pipes from freezing. That changes what we recommend versus a colder climate: polyurethane-core panels for comfort and quiet, not as a frost guard.

Opener compatibility gets checked too. A lot of 2001-built garages still have the original chain-drive opener, and it usually bolts back up fine to a new door, but if the travel limits or the safety sensors are out of spec we say so before we hang anything, not after.

Are most Heath garage doors original to the house?

A lot of them are. Heath's housing stock centers on 2001, and many of those original steel doors are still in place. At this age the springs are typically past their rated cycle life even when the door still looks fine, which is the main reason people call for a full replacement rather than a patch repair.

Will insulation matter much in Heath's climate?

The area sits in a moderate heat band, not extreme cold, so insulated panels matter more for cutting noise and keeping the garage cooler in summer than for frost protection. If you use the garage as workspace, that comfort difference is usually worth it.
